When is the best time to book a flight from Tel Aviv to Paris?

The price of a flight from Tel Aviv to Paris changes depending on how far ahead you book. For the best chance of a lower fare, book around 24 days before departure, when the average ticket costs about $469. Fares also tend to climb as the departure date gets closer.

About the Tel Aviv — Paris flight

On this page, you can find and book flights from Tel Aviv to Paris. A direct flight on this route covers a distance of 3,282 km, with a total frequency of around 48 flights per week.

The main carriers on this route are El Al, Air France, and Transavia France. Ticket prices are dynamic, so we recommend using the low-fare calendar and checking in advance how to get to the departure airport and how to travel from the airport to the city center.

When to fly

The warmest time to visit is during July and August, with average temperatures reaching up to 25°C, while the wettest and coolest period is December, which sees up to 88.54 mm of rainfall.

The lowest flight price was recorded in February, starting $87. The most expensive month to book is May, when prices start $208.

To save money, consider January or February as a compromise between price and weather. We recommend avoiding peak dates in May if finding a budget ticket is your priority.

How to get the best deal on a Tel Aviv — Paris ticket

  • Book your tickets at least 6–8 weeks before departure to secure the best fares from full-service carriers.
  • Consider flights by low-cost carriers like Transavia France or Israir — they are often cheaper, but be sure to check the baggage allowance.
  • Compare prices for nearby dates in the low-fare calendar: sometimes flying a day earlier or later can save you $38.
  • Direct flights save about 4 hours of travel time, while layovers at major hubs can reduce the overall ticket price.

Frequently asked questions about the Tel Aviv — Paris flight

How long is the flight from Tel Aviv to Paris?

The distance between the cities is approximately 3,282 km. A direct flight usually takes between 4 hours 40 minutes and 5 hours, depending on the airline and weather conditions.

Which airlines operate flights on this route?

The main carriers are El Al, Air France, Transavia France, Arkia, and Israir. This page provides an up-to-date list of all companies operating flights on your selected dates.

Are there direct flights?

Yes, there are about 48 flights per week on this route, many of which are direct. You can filter for these in the search results.

How much is the cheapest ticket?

Flight prices change constantly based on demand and booking time. You can find current minimum prices for the upcoming year in the low-fare calendar section on this page.

Which airport does the flight arrive at?

Most flights from Tel Aviv arrive at Paris international airports — Charles de Gaulle (CDG) or Orly (ORY).
